Neighborhood Overview
High Point Central High sits within a well-established residential and commercial section of High Point, making it easily accessible via the primary local thoroughfares. Visitors arriving from out of town typically utilize Interstate 85 or Highway 311, which connect the school to the broader Triad region. The campus features designated on-site parking for events, though capacity can tighten during high-attendance matchups. Piedmont Triad International Airport (GSO) is the primary gateway for air travelers, located approximately a twenty-minute drive to the north of the venue.
Navigating the area is straightforward, as most amenities are located just a short drive along main roads like South Main Street. While the immediate vicinity of the school is largely residential, the proximity to the city center allows for quick access to various dining and retail options. Rideshare services are readily available in the city, providing a convenient alternative for those who prefer not to navigate event parking. For the best experience, we recommend arriving at least thirty minutes before your scheduled start time to secure a spot and settle in before the action begins.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winters are typically cool and crisp, with average temperatures in the 40s and 50s. Visitors should pack layers, including jackets and sweaters, to stay comfortable during outdoor events. While snow is rare, it is always a possibility, so check the forecast before you travel to ensure you are prepared.
Spring & early summer
This is a beautiful time to visit, with temperatures warming up into the 60s and 70s. The weather is generally pleasant for outdoor activities, though spring showers are common. Pack a mix of light clothing and a waterproof jacket to stay comfortable throughout the day.
Mid-summer
Expect hot and humid conditions, with temperatures frequently climbing into the 80s and 90s. High levels of hydration are essential for all athletes and spectators. Lightweight, breathable clothing and plenty of sunscreen are strongly recommended for anyone spending time at the outdoor fields.
Fall season
Fall offers some of the best weather of the year, with cool, comfortable temperatures and lower humidity. It is an ideal season for sports, though mornings can be chilly. Dressing in layers allows you to adjust to the changing temperature throughout the day as the sun rises.
Rain & snow
Rain can occur throughout the year, so always have a plan for wet weather. Keep umbrellas and rain gear handy, as events may continue through light drizzle. Snow is infrequent but can cause travel delays, so monitor local news if cold fronts are expected during your trip.
